    I'm not aware of any coffee shops near the airport although I'm sure
    sombody will prove me wrong.
    You have plenty of time still to get to Amsterdam as the train from
    the airport to central station leave every 20 mins and the journey
    takes about the same time too.

    Head to a street called Warmoestraat, just past the Grasshopper. Here you
    will find a load of coffee shops within striking distance to one another.
    Hill Street Blues (get to the den at the back for the view)
    Baba
    Sheeba
    Coffee shop 36 (get to the den at the back for the view)
    Greenhouse
    Hunters Bar

    The fastest way from Schipol to a coffeeshop is to take the train to Amsterdam central station. Within a 10 minute walk of central station there are close to 50 coffeeshops.

    I would suggest Coffeeshop 420, a couple minute walk south on Damrak to about your 4th alley on your right, take right on Oudebrugsteeg, and then 30 yards down on your left.
